[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of water turbine governor control, and particularly relates to a feedforward power closed-loop regulation method and system based on active change rate. BACKGROUND
[0002] As the core control equipment of hydroelectric generating units, the water turbine governor plays an irreplaceable role in regulating unit frequency, achieving rapid synchronization and grid connection, and increasing and decreasing load. In practical applications, the water turbine governor is a highly coupled water-mechanical-electrical integrated control system, which has dead zone, time delay characteristics and non-minimum phase characteristics, and also needs to meet multiple constraint conditions such as actuator stroke, speed rise rate during load shedding, water pressure rise rate, and shutdown speed, which makes the research and optimization of the control strategy of the water turbine governor face many challenges.
[0003] With the rapid development of extra-high voltage power grids and the large-scale grid-connected operation of new energy, some regional power grids such as the Southwest Power Grid and the Yunnan Power Grid operate in an asynchronous manner with the main grid. These regional hydropower units have a huge installed capacity, and the water hammer effect generated by large-scale hydropower units during primary frequency regulation can cause ultra-low frequency oscillation in the grid, seriously threatening the safe and stable operation of the grid. To eliminate this risk, the industry generally reduces the active regulation speed by adjusting the PID parameters of the water turbine governor, which ensures the stability of the grid but significantly reduces the active regulation performance indicators of the AGC (Automatic Generation Control) of the unit.
[0004] CN116044645A discloses a water turbine generator set governor power feedforward control correction method, which directly generates the required control output according to the target power formed by the given power and the primary frequency signal and the current working water head, has faster regulation speed and no over-regulation phenomenon compared with feedback control, and corrects the feedforward control through feedback correction to make the feedforward control have self-learning function, so that the feedforward control can finally realize high-precision regulation. The present application is suitable for grid-connected control of water turbine governors. However, it does not optimize the scene of increased inertia and lag of the system after the PID parameters are adjusted, lacks a mechanism to limit the given power change rate, and may cause fluctuations during regulation; it is difficult to balance the regulation speed and stability under the condition of limited PID parameters, and cannot accurately solve the core problem of the decline of AGC active regulation performance.
[0005] CN117212037A provides a control system and method for optimizing water turbine speed regulation performance based on feedforward control, in which a PID speed regulator receives a guide vane opening error signal, and the error signal is processed through proportional The integral control adjusts and outputs a first guide vane opening degree instruction value to an electro-hydraulic servo system; when the load condition of the hydraulic turbine speed regulation system changes or the AGC instruction needs to adjust the power output, the feedforward control system obtains the difference between the current operating state quantity of the hydraulic turbine speed regulation system and the set reference operating condition state quantity and generates a second guide vane opening degree instruction value, which is output to the electro-hydraulic servo system; the electro-hydraulic servo system generates an output guide vane opening degree value according to the first guide vane opening degree instruction value and the second guide vane opening degree instruction value to control the guide vane action of the hydraulic turbine and the water diversion system; and the hydraulic turbine and the water diversion system drive the generator and the load to operate. However, the feedforward control only generates an instruction based on the difference between the operating state quantity and the reference condition quantity, without combining the active change rate to design a targeted compensation logic, so it cannot effectively deal with the problem of slow dynamic response after the PID parameter is adjusted to be low; the entering and exiting conditions of the feedforward link are not explicitly limited, so the feedforward may be started in non-adaptive conditions such as no-load operation and opening degree operation, which may affect the adjustment effect; and there is a lack of design for filtering high-frequency noise and inhibiting signal overshoot, so the adjustment stability is insufficient and it is difficult to meet the strict requirements in the asynchronous interconnection scenario of the power grid.
[0006] In summary, under the premise of meeting the requirements of primary frequency regulation performance in the asynchronous interconnection operation of the power grid, how to effectively improve the AGC active regulation performance of the unit and solve the problem of insufficient active regulation speed after the PID parameter is adjusted to be low has become an important topic in the research on the regulation strategy of the hydraulic turbine governor. [0038] Embodiment 2 This embodiment is based on Embodiment 1: As Figure 2 shown, the embodiment provides a feedforward power closed-loop regulation method based on active change rate, which includes: according to the unit operating state and the governor operating mode, controlling the switching of the feedforward function, when the given power P c is a constant value, the feedforward function is automatically removed, and the primary frequency modulation normally functions; when the given power P c increases / decreases in a ramp function, the Y pid of the governor power PID module is compensated in advance through a lead-lag correction parameter module to offset the inertial lag of the given power P c , effectively improving the dynamic response speed of the power PID regulation, so that the active power of the unit can monotonically and quickly track the power set value.
[0039] Correspondingly, the embodiment provides a feedforward power closed-loop regulation system based on active change rate, which includes: a slope rate module (LIMITER) for limiting the change rate of the given power Pc; a lead-lag correction parameter module; a first-order inertial link and a first-order differential link are combined into a feedforward compensation link with a transfer function G(s)=Ks / (Ts+1), which is used to offset the inertial lag of the given power P c and compensate in advance; a feedforward function automatic switching module for controlling the timing of the feedforward function; a feedforward multiplier (M) for superimposing the feedforward compensation output by the lead-lag correction parameter module on the Ypid calculated and output by the governor power PID module to achieve the purpose of accelerating the active regulation speed.
[0040] Preferably, in the feedforward function automatic switching module, when the unit governor is in no-load operation, opening degree operation or the unit outlet circuit breaker is in the tripped state, the feedforward function is removed by switching to the value 0 through the multiplier M and multiplying the feedforward correction parameter; when the unit is in grid-connected operation and the governor is in power mode operation, the feedforward function is put into operation by switching to the value 1 through the multiplier M and multiplying the feedforward correction parameter.
[0041] Preferably, in the ramp rate module, in order to match the actual rate of the hydro-turbine governor load adjustment, the ramp rate module is set to make the given power P c received by the governor change at a rate close to the actual rate of the hydro-turbine governor load adjustment, rather than in steps, so that the power adjustment can be more smooth and smooth, and at the same time prevent false alarm governor master follow-up failure and the like. The ramp rate module generally has two internal parameter variables, one is the setting range of the given power P c from 0 to P max , and the other is the change rate K, which is set to 1% P g / s (P g is the rated power of the unit) by default, and the range is 0~5% P g / s adjustable.
[0042] Preferably, in the lead-lag correction parameter module, a first-order inertia link and a first-order differential link are combined in series to form a feedforward compensation link, and the transfer function G(s)=Ks / (Ts+1), wherein the numerator Ks is a typical differential link (sensitive to the change rate of the input signal, and responds strongly to fast-changing signals), and the denominator Ts+1 is a first-order inertia link (filters high-frequency noise, introduces a time constant Ts lag, and avoids signal overshoot). The combination of the two has the characteristics of both the differential link and the inertia link. The time-domain step response presents the characteristics of rapid rise and slow approach to the steady-state value K - the output changes rapidly with time at the initial time (t→0) (differential characteristic), and then is gradually stabilized by the inertia link (inertial characteristic). The main parameter variables include the gain coefficient Ks and the time constant Ts, wherein the gain coefficient Ks is set to 0~10, and the default setting is 6; the time constant Ts is set to 0~1s, and the default setting is 0.1s.
